what is the value of x in the eqation 3 [2x+5]=3x+4x

Answer:

x = 15

Step-by-step explanation:

3 ( 2x + 5 ) = 3x + 4x

Distribute;

3 ( 2x + 5 ) = 3x + 4x

6x + 15 = 3x + 4 x

Combine like terms;

6x + 15 = 3x + 4x

6x + 15 = 7x

Inverse operations;

6x + 15 = 7x

-6x           -6x

15 = x
